A passenger in a train moving at an acceleration a', drops a stone from the window. A person, standing on the ground, by the sides of the rails, observes the ball following:

(a) Vertically with acceleration g2+a2

(b) Horizontally with acceleration g2+a2

(c) Along a parabola with acceleration g2+a2

(d) Along a parabola with acceleration g

Open in App
Solution

Whatever may be the acceleration of the train when the stone is throne from the train it will not acquire the horizontal acceleration of the train.

For horizontal

x=vt

For vertical

y=12gt2

After combining

y=12gx2v2

The above equation is the equation of the parabola.

Hence we can say that the stone will travel with a parabolic path with the acceleration g.
